Black history movies you need to watch

'A Raisin in the Sun' (1961) -
In this movie, Sidney Poitier tells the story of a family who receive a life insurance check.

'Glory' (1989) -
This movie takes us back to the American Civil War and is about one of the first all-Black regiments of the Union Army.

'Do the Right Thing' (1989) -
This film tackles racial tensions in New York City. But in true Spike Lee style, it adds funny elements to a serious matter.

'Malcolm X' (1992) -
An outstanding portrayal of the African-American human rights activist and Nation of Islam minister, Malcolm X.

'42' (2013) -
This movie is a biopic about the career of the first Black Major League Baseball player, Jackie Robinson.

'12 Years a Slave' (2013) -
This film tells the story of a free man who is kidnapped and sold into slavery in Louisiana. It's based on the memoir of Solomon Northup.

'Selma' (2014) -
A must-watch movie about the Civil Rights Movement and Martin Luther King Jr.'s campaign to secure equal voting rights.

'Hidden Figures' (2016) -
This movie tells the story of female African-American mathematicians who had an important role in NASA and the US space race.

'Mudbound' (2017) -
Two families struggle with social and racial injustices in rural Mississippi after two men return home from World War II and try to adjust to their new life.

'BlacKkKlansman' (2018) -
A Black detective and a Jewish detective infiltrate the KKK in this film from Spike Lee.

='One Night in Miami' (2020) -
Malcolm X, Muhammad Ali, Jim Brown, and Sam Cooke get together to discuss their roles in the Civil Rights Movement.

'Judas and the Black Messiah' (2021) - This movie is about an FBI informant who infiltrates the Illinois Black Panther Party.
